Gas vs Electric Pool Heaters
When selecting a backyard warmth solution, Vernon homeowners often weigh the pros of a natural gas thermal unit against an resistive heater. Gas pool heaters deliver rapid heating, ideal for occasional pool use, while resistive units offer consistent warmth with fewer moving parts. However, gas models may have higher operating costs, especially during colder months in the interior climate.
- Affordable initial price for propane units
- Increased energy use in freezing weather
- Quick water warming than coil-based systems
Advantages of Pool Heat Pump Installation
Thermal transfer setup is one of the most eco-friendly warmth solutions options available in Vernon. These units pull heat from the surrounding air, making them incredibly efficient over time—especially during moderate Okanagan summers. A HVAC specialist can ensure your climate-responsive system is properly sized and installed for maximum performance and extended savings on monthly energy bills.
- Significant utility savings vs gas heaters
- Longer heater lifespan with routine maintenance

Selecting High-Efficiency Pool Heaters
When investing in swimming pool heating setup, selecting an energy-efficient pool heating can drastically reduce operating costs. Look for models with high COP (Coefficient of Performance) ratings, programmable controls, and digital thermostats that adapt to Vernon’s variable climate. A licensed contractor can guide you toward reliable brands that meet local codes and offer extended warranties for long-term protection.

Average Installation Price Range
The thermal system price in Vernon varies widely based on type, size, and complexity. On average, a combustion-based unit installation ranges from $2,500 to $4,500, while heat pump installation costs $3,000–$5,500. Photovoltaic warmth systems setups average $3,500–$7,000 but come with durable savings. Always request a no-cost quote from a certified technician to compare cost-effective solution packages.

Ongoing Pool Heater Costs
Beyond the initial installation fee, consider the monthly energy use of your system. Propane models typically cost $50–$150/month in winter, while air-source units run $20–$60. Solar pool heating can reduce ongoing costs to nearly zero. Regular pool heater maintenance by a licensed contractor extends system durability and keeps efficiency high.

Cold-Climate System Sizing
Undersized heaters struggle in Vernon’s chilly months, leading to high energy bills. Proper system sizing ensures your unit can handle temperature drops and still maintain comfort. A licensed contractor performs a heat load calculation based on pool size, wind exposure, and insulation to recommend the ideal BTU or kW output. Oversizing isn’t the answer either—efficient balanced systems match demand without waste.
